Time to cut some fat so i'm back on low carb for a few months. Shooting for 3mo so i have a month to reverse diet before we head out on the road for Austin and the F1 race. :)

So in addition to the diet i've been doing hypertrophy for a couple of weeks now.

Today was supposed to be HT arms but my elbow has been a bit naggy since starting HT so i laid off the tricep stuff and only did 2 exercises. Did 5 bicep exercises for a billion reps lol
I started today out by doing 5x5 squats @ 135 and had NO back trouble. So that's super encouraging. The weight felt light (as it should) but the real goal was form and to be pain free by the time it was done. Mission accomplished. I'm planning on doing 5x5 squats twice per week and just taking 20lb jumps per week until i'm back up to repping 405.

Tomorrow is some bench press and some deadlifting. I'm to the place where 500 comes up pretty smoothly every time but I've really been focusing on my DL form so I started doing 5x5 @ 315 last week, shooting to increase by 20lbs/wk. Pulling once from the floor and then once from a 6in rack pull. I've gotten myself a nice little routine going pre-pull and it's helped me a LOT when it comes to locking my lats in and really making the motion about driving my hips through.
